Smock leads L-S girls to fourth, PCM finishes fifth at Pella Christian

Mustangs, Hawks lose to pair of 3A programs

PELLA — PCM and Lynnville-Sully competed for the first time since ia.varsitybound.com released its track and field power rankings.

Both the L-S and PCM girls are ranked in the top 10 of their respective classes and they were separated by just two points on Tuesday at the Pella Christian Coed Invitational.

Greenlee Smock scored 25 points for the Hawks and Caitlin Alberts scored 15.5 as the Hawks were fourth with 82 points. PCM scored 80 points in fifth, led by 18 from Margo Chipps, 11 from Celeste Wagaman and 10 from Chelsea Bird.

The nine-team field featured a variety of schools. Class 3A Pella (176) and ADM (122) finished at the top and 1A Wayne (108) finished third.

The rest of the field including 2A Centerville (55), Pella Christian (50), Pleasantville (40) and Eddyville-Blakesburg-Fremont (8).

Smock led the area athletes. She won the 800- and 3,000-meter runs and was fourth in the 1,500.

She finished the 800 in 2 minutes, 40.91 seconds and Alberts was second in 2:41.09. Smock won the 3K in 12:18.97 and her time in the 1,500 was 5:50.89.

Alberts also finished third in the 400 with a time of 1:06.89.

The Hawks’ distance medley relay team was second as the foursome of Aliya James, Dylann Huyser, Megan Van Zante and Cayler Noun Harder finished in 5:04.27.

The 4x100 relay also was third. Reagan McFarland, James, Carsyn McFarland and Huyser finished in 54.67 seconds. The 4x800 relay team also was third as Alberts, Kinsley Tice, Van Zante and Noun Harder finished in 11:16.2.

Chipps led the Mustangs with a 400 hurdles win and a runner-up finish in the 100 hurdles.

Chipps won the 400 hurdles with a time of 1:09.52 and took second in the 100 hurdles in 16.68. Bird finished third in the 100 hurdles in 17.64.

Wagaman also won the high jump with a leap of 4 feet, 10 inches.

The Mustangs were third in the 4x200 and shuttle hurdle relays. In the 4x200, Belle Hudnut, Reece Palm, Elle Davis and Alissa Ives finished in 2:05.19 and the shuttle hurdle team of Hudnut, Avery Houser, Eliana Buswell and Kate McClellen completed the race in 1:13.74.

Delaney Baird was fourth in the 400 with a time of 1:08.2, Bird finished fifth in the 100 in 13.76 and Ryan Bennett finished sixth in the 200 in 30.76.
